Ready to design once‑in‑a‑lifetime travel experiences across the globe? We're looking for an experienced Travel Sales Consultant to join our Brighton team, specialising in complex, tailor‑made and round‑the‑world trips.

  • Full time (40 hours per week, Monday to Friday)
  • Part time (minimum of 28 hours per week across Monday to Friday)
  • Permanent
What you’ll be doing

We specialise in all aspects of round‑the‑world travel, so your role will be interesting and varied. You'll be putting together complex multi‑stop and round‑the‑world itineraries for some clients and fully tailor‑made holidays for others.

You'll have autonomy over your day‑to‑day workload which will involve talking to customers on the phone, by email and occasionally face to face. You'll also work closely with the product team, suppliers and with the other consultants to help create fully tailored, completely bespoke trips of a lifetime. You'll manage the full process from initial quote through to booking and after‑sales support.

What we’re looking for

We have a number of popular destinations around the world, including North and South America, Asia, Australasia and the South Pacific. We look for personal travel experience across several of these regions as this is essential for the role.

Besides a passion for travel, we do also require that our sales consultants can demonstrate:

  • Solid long‑haul sales experience, preferably in complex, multi‑stop and tailor‑made trips
  • A proven track record of securing sales in a customer‑focused environment
  • Competency of using the GDS (Amadeus, Galileo, Worldspan or Sabre)
  • Effective time management and organisational skills
  • Strong communication skills – both verbal and written
